A Cricket in the Ear

A Cricket in the Ear (Bulgarian: Щурец в ухото / Shturets v uhoto) is a Bulgarian comedy-drama film released in 1976, directed by Georgi K. Stoyanov, starring Pavel Popandov, Stefan Mavrodiev, Itzhak Fintzi, Tatyana Lolova and Petar Slabakov.

A comedy with a spice of drama about two young men who live in the country but decide to move to the big city.

All the travel turns into a reason for consideration and giving a new meaning to their past and future life.

Evtim (Popandov) and Pesho (Mavrodiev), two young men, decided to leave their native village and move to the big city.

Standing by the road, amid a heap of luggage, they turned to be a colorful view as hitch-hikers to the passing vehicles.
